$ZETA
ZETA’s revenue growth is strong; cash generation is clearly strong; operating cash flow has been positive for 11 quarters and is in an uptrend, and levered FCF is steady in the $38M–$58M range. The gross profit structure is solid and margins are holding up, while operating profitability is at a threshold stage and has been choppy quarter to quarter.
PEG Non-GAAP (FWD) is 0.95, meaning it’s cheap. The balance sheet is strong with roughly $385M in cash and $208M in debt, the company is net cash; liquidity is comfortable and interest expense is low. Tangible book value improved meaningfully into 2025.

It raised FY2026 expectations, and in Q3 it showed strong operating leverage and conversion to higher profit with 26% revenue growth, 69% EPS growth, and 55% FCF growth...
